Basic Concepts of Injector Fuel Supply Tubes
An Injector Fuel Supply Tube is a conduit within the fuel system that directs fuel from the fuel rail to the injectors. Its function is to maintain a steady flow of fuel under pressure, which is crucial for the injectors to atomize the fuel properly during combustion. This contributes to the engine’s overall performance by ensuring that fuel is delivered efficiently and effectively to the combustion chamber 2.

Compatibility with Specific Cummins Engines
The injector fuel supply tube is compatible with the following Cummins engines:
- X15 CM2350 X123B
- X15 CM2350 X134B
- X15 CM2450 X134B
These engines are part of the Cummins lineup and are known for their robust design and reliability in various applications. The injector fuel supply tube is engineered to fit seamlessly with these engines, ensuring a secure and leak-proof connection that is crucial for the proper functioning of the fuel system 11.

Integration with Fuel Rail and Injectors
The Injector Fuel Supply Tube connects directly to the fuel rail, which is a pressurized conduit that distributes fuel to each injector. The tube’s design allows it to fit securely into the fuel rail, maintaining a sealed connection that prevents fuel leaks and ensures that the fuel pressure remains stable.
Each injector is equipped with a nozzle that sprays atomized fuel into the combustion chamber. The Injector Fuel Supply Tube delivers fuel under pressure to these injectors, allowing them to operate efficiently. The consistent fuel pressure and flow rate are essential for the injectors to atomize the fuel properly, which is vital for optimal combustion and engine performance 14.
Interaction with Plumbing Components
In the broader context of the engine’s fuel system, the Injector Fuel Supply Tube interacts with various plumbing components. These include fuel lines, filters, and regulators. The tube must be compatible with these components to ensure a seamless fuel flow from the tank to the injectors.
Fuel lines transport fuel from the tank to the engine, while filters remove impurities that could clog the injectors or damage other components. Regulators maintain the correct fuel pressure within the system. The Injector Fuel Supply Tube must be designed to withstand the pressures and temperatures within these plumbing components, ensuring reliable performance over time 15.
Ensuring System Integrity
The Injector Fuel Supply Tube plays a significant role in maintaining the integrity of the fuel system. By providing a dedicated pathway for fuel, it helps to isolate the injectors from fluctuations in fuel pressure that might occur elsewhere in the system. This isolation contributes to more precise fuel delivery and enhances the overall efficiency and reliability of the engine 16.
